From its opening in 1776 until it closed in 1835, Walnut Street Jail operated as the county jail of Philadelphia. From 1790 until 1818, it also operated as Pennsylvania's only state prison. ( Library of Congress) Overcrowding, corruption, violence, and bribery ran rampant in Philadelphia's early jails. A broken system of federal oversight. America's 3,000-plus jails are typically run by county sheriffs or local police. They often are under-equipped and understaffed, starved for funds by local ...In Atlanta's Fulton County Jail, the overcrowding has meant death. 10 inmates have died this year at the jail. And there's no solution yet as the court system is still playing catchup from COVID-19 shutdowns.
